| 359063 | 2005-05-28 00:49:00 | Hi A while ago I did a disk cleanup and one of the options was to compress old files. I did that. Now when I open Officexp Excel it asks to install but it also works if I press cancel a number of times. Access has problems, so does outlook. I think it must have something to do with compressing their files (as I mainly use Word). I went through the Windows folder and spent some time uncompressing files but it didn't fix the Excel problem. Is there a way to uncompress all these files? I have no system restore point as my computer was recently ravaged by viruses. Thanks |
